We welcome fellow promotees Nottingham Forest to the Cottage for a “traditional” 15:00 Saturday afternoon kick-off

Fulham v Forest

Isn’t it strange that as a Fulham fan I can be disappointed with only taking 4 points from Chelsea this season!? Much has been said of Chelsea’s spending over both transfer windows, how have they got away with spending so much, FFP and all that?, anyhow the way that Marco has made Fulham such a cohesive unit, every player playing for the “team”, really fluent in possession, well drilled off the ball, very difficult to break down and full of confidence, shows that you don’t have to spend a large fortune to gain success.

Forest have also spent a fortune in both transfer windows, they’ve bought around 30 players and currently sit in 13th, 6 points off of 18, i think that their still in the mist of the relegation battle and will be desperate for any points.
The 2-3 scoreline from September’s reverse fixture didn’t really tell the story of the game. Fulham found themselves a goal down early in the game only to score 3 times in five minutes in the second half, Forest, against the run of play, scored a consolation late on in a largely comfortable game for Fulham.

Current Form:
Fulham – WWLLD
Forest – LDWWW

Our recent record against Forest is reasonably even with 7 wins, 5 losses and a draw
